FOX 56 News is located in Lexington, KY and is a part of Nexstar Media Group. Nexstar Media Group is America's largest local television and media company. Nexstar's platform delivers exceptional local content and network programming to inform and entertain viewers, while providing premium, scalable local advertising opportunities for advertisers and brands across all screens and devices. Learn more at www.Nexstar.tv.
The Client Solutions Specialist works in the FOX 56 Sales Department and assists FOX 56 Marketing Consultants to deliver social media content, website development and maintenance, video production and anything else needed to make FOX 56's advertising campaigns successful.
This position reports to the Director of Sales but will be a supporting role to the FOX 56 Management team and its client-facing Marketing Consultants.
  • Meets with Marketing Consultants (FOX 56 Sales Representatives) and clients to create custom content strategies for clients
  • Implement custom content strategies
  • Website management
  • Video production
  • Ability to meet with customers and develop creative ideas
  • Travel to customer locations to shoot videos, take pictures, or create content
  • Comfortable interacting with clients and being part of sales presentations
  • Other duties as assigned by Director of Sales or Sales Management

Requirements & Skills:
  • Social Media Management
  • Video production and editing
  • Ability to maintain and update customer websites on platforms such as WordPress
  • Expertise in Canva or similar graphic design platforms
  • Power Point proficiency a plus
  • Microsoft Excel proficiency a plus
  • Excellent communication skills, both oral and written
  • Minimum one year's experience in a marketing or social media related position

Headquartered in Irving, Texas, Nexstar Media Group, Inc. is the largest local broadcast television group in the United States and one of the world’s leading diversified media companies. In June 2023, Nexstar marked 27 years of excellence in local programming and service since Perry A. Sook founded the company. Nexstar owns, operates, programs or provides sales and other services to 200 broadcast stations (including partner stations) and their related low power and digital multicast signals reaching 116 markets or more than 68% of all U.S. television households. Coupled with a growing portfolio of digital media marketing, advertising and content management platforms, Nexstar delivers powerful and innovative digital solutions and services to local and national media companies, advertisers, agencies and brands.
